The interaction between the buy-side and sell-side additionally has implications for retirement planning. The buy-side, for example, invests in securities issued by the sell-side to develop retirement funds. The sell-side, however, offers retirement savings products and services that people and employers can use to plan for retirement. The sell-side additionally provides a variety of companies to the buy-side, including trading providers, research, and financial advisory providers. A sell-side analyst is employed by a brokerage or firm that handles individual accounts, providing recommendations to the firm’s purchasers. In The Meantime what is buy side vs sell side, a buy-side analyst typically works for institutional traders like hedge funds, pension funds, or mutual funds. These analysts conduct research and advise the money managers within their funds. LBOs are considerably unpopular as a result of the sell-side company may not have a say within the transaction. Elon Musk’s takeover of Twitter is the most notable leveraged buyout in recent history, and the common public reaction to that illustrates the backlash that may accompany an LBO. In a leveraged buyout, the buy-side company borrows a sum of cash to amass the sell-side company. Corporations can borrow as a lot as 90% of the equity wanted for the deal, putting up as little as 10% of the deal value.
